A Cape George Cutter 36, Magic Carpet, cruises the British Columbia coast toward Toba Inlet to anchor in Brehm Bay, a known grizzly bear habitat.8:56 The crew navigates the inlet’s steep, mountainous terrain, where limited anchoring ledges and significant depths—often exceeding 30 meters—require precise positioning and substantial chain. Localized wind systems within the inlet create unpredictable gusts and whitecaps, complicating the approach and requiring careful scouting to avoid underwater logging debris. The crew anchors in 36 meters of water alongside two other vessels, relying on their ground tackle to hold in the narrow, exposed estuary.18:22 Despite the challenges of filming from a moving boat in windy conditions, the crew successfully observes a golden-colored grizzly bear moving through the tall grass of the estuary.27:52 The experience highlights the necessity of patience and observation when wildlife spotting in remote, seasonal environments. Proper anchoring technique and sufficient chain are essential for safety in the steep, debris-filled inlets of the BC coast.
